What are Parametric Constraints?

Parametric constraints allow you to define rules between drawing objects.

Instead of drawing elements that operate independently, it is possible to create relationships that determine how the geometry should behave when a change occurs.

For example:

  • Two lines can remain parallel
  • Two circles can remain concentric
  • One point may coincide with another
  • A length may remain fixed
  • An angle can be set to a specific value

These relationships make geometry smarter and more predictable.


What Changes When Applied to Dynamic Blocks?

Parametric constraints could already be used in the geometry of a drawing. The big new feature is the ability to integrate them directly into dynamic blocks.

This means that a block is no longer just a set of grouped objects.

Start functioning as an intelligent rule-based component.

When a parameter is changed:

  • The geometric relationships are maintained
  • The dimensions adjust automatically
  • The shape of the block remains consistent

Instead of redesigning elements, you simply alter the defined parameters.


How to Edit a Dynamic Block

To add parametric constraints, the block must be opened in the Block Editor.

You can do it in two ways.

Method 1: Select the Block

Select a block reference in the drawing and open the Block Editor.


Method 2: Use the Command Line

Write

BEDIT or be

Then select the block you want from the list provided.

The Block Editor will open and you can begin defining the necessary constraints.


Types of Restrictions Available

Restrictions are generally divided into two categories.

Geometric Constraints

They govern the relationships between objects.

Examples

  • Parallel
  • Perpendicular
  • Concentric
  • Coincidental
  • Horizontal
  • Vertical
  • Tangent

These constraints ensure that the geometry maintains the correct relationships during changes.


Dimensional Restrictions

They monitor specific values.

Examples

  • Greetings
  • Distances
  • Lightning
  • Diameters
  • Angles

When one of these values is changed, all the associated geometry is updated automatically.


1. Less Manual Labour

One of the biggest advantages is the reduction in manual adjustments.

Without parametric constraints, a simple change to the size of a component may force you to:

  • Move rows
  • Adjust arches
  • Reposition circles
  • Update dimensions

With the defined restrictions, the block itself adapts automatically.

This makes revisions much quicker.


2. More Consistent Geometry

Traditional blocks already allow actions such as:

  • Stretch
  • Move
  • Rotate
  • Mirror (Flip)
  • Change visibility

However, they do not always guarantee that the geometric relationships are maintained.

Parametric constraints add an extra layer of control.

For example:

  • An axle remains centred
  • A hole remains concentric
  • Two faces remain parallel

Even after several changes.


3. More Efficient Global Updates

When a change is made within the block definition, all references to that block can be updated throughout the drawing.

Imagine a detail that is used fifty times in a project.

Instead of locating and editing each instance individually:

  1. Open the notepad
  2. Adjust the parameters
  3. Save the change

All references may reflect the new definition.

This significantly reduces the risk of forgetting elements during a review.


4. Flexibility at the Instance Level

Not all alterations need to affect every block.

One of the advantages of dynamic blocks is the ability to expose parameters to the user.

These parameters can be changed directly in the drawing space by:

  • Grips
  • Properties
  • Parametric values

In this way, a single instance can be adjusted without modifying the main block definition.

Practical Example: A Fastener

Imagine a mechanical drawing that uses the same fastener in several places.

Within the Block Editor, rules can be defined such as:

  • The central axle remains aligned
  • The circles remain concentric
  • The side faces remain parallel
  • The length is controlled by a parameter
  • The diameter is controlled by another parameter

When it is necessary to change the component:

  • The user only changes the parameters
  • The geometry adapts automatically
  • The form remains correct
  • All references can be updated together

The result is a much faster and more reliable process.


An Important Note

Although the changes made inside the block update its internal geometry, elements external to the block still require verification.

For example:

  • Adjoining walls
  • Connection lines
  • External dimensions
  • Other related elements

As with any design change, a final check remains recommended.
